Know the Signs

Ant Control Red Flags Every Arlington Homeowner Should Know

Ants cause nuisance trails and contaminate food surfaces in Arlington homes. Wet foundations and humid air allow them to nest in walls and crawl spaces. Carpenter ants also chew damp wood, weakening frames if ignored.

Trailing Lines Indoors

Visible ant trails from entry points to food sources along baseboards or counters

Sawdust-Like Frass

Small piles of debris near wood suggesting carpenter ant tunneling activity

Nest Mounds Outside

Soil mounds near the foundation or pavement cracks that serve as colony entrances

About Ant Control

You spot long lines of ants crossing your kitchen counter after a storm or find sawdust near baseboards. In Arlington, humidity and wet foundations attract ants to warmth and water inside homes. These pests nest quickly in damp wood or gaps under sinks. You want them gone so your home feels clean and safe again.

Our ant inspection locates entry trails, nests, and moisture sites that attract activity. Technicians check window frames, plumbing gaps, and crawl-space beams common in Arlington houses. We apply gel baits, barrier sprays, and moisture controls tailored to the species found. Treatments focus on both immediate removal and correction of damp conditions encouraging reentry.

Within days, ant movement declines as colonies feed on bait and die off. We follow up to make sure the nest is eliminated entirely. When homes stay dry and entry points sealed, Arlington residents enjoy long-lasting peace of mind and cleaner living spaces.

Local Context

Why Arlington’s Moisture Draws Ants Indoors

Arlington’s position along the Stillaguamish River keeps soil wet even after dry weeks. Moisture ants and carpenter ants thrive in this setting. Houses in Arlington Heights and Sisco Heights, often surrounded by trees and clay soils, face frequent ant migrations during spring rain and summer warmth.

Technicians inspect rooms, crawl areas, and exterior zones where ants travel. In Arlington, they focus on damp wood and plumbing leaks. Treatments use baits, cracks-and-crevice sprays, and perimeter barriers to stop ants quickly.
Most surface ants decline in two to three days. Deep colonies may take a week to collapse. Keeping counters dry and sealing entry spots helps extend the results, especially in Arlington’s repeated rainy periods.
Yes, we use targeted baits and precise perimeter applications. These follow EPA-registered standards for indoor safety. Once surfaces dry, normal activities can resume without concern for kids or pets.
Store sprays may kill visible ants but miss nests inside damp walls. In Arlington’s climate, moisture ants keep returning unless nesting sites are removed. Professional treatments ensure the colony’s queen and workers are fully eliminated.
Seeing a few ants initially is normal as they carry bait back to colonies. Follow-up visits confirm full elimination. In very wet weeks, perimeter reapplications hold off reinvasion from surrounding soil nests.
Carpenter ants are large and often leave fine sawdust near wood trim. Sugar ants are tiny and trail to sweets in kitchens. In Arlington’s damp homes, both types may appear together around plumbing and crawl spaces.
Moist air and soft ground near the river encourage ant colonies to thrive. During storms, nests flood and ants move inside looking for dry shelter. That’s why homeowners around Trafton often find sudden indoor trails after rainfall.
Wipe up visible food sources and clear under sinks so technicians can inspect plumbing lines. Removing standing water and clutter helps identify nest zones quickly, improving the treatment’s reach and durability.
